National Highways Limited Message:

We will soon be carrying out resurfacing works to the A27 near Falmer, Brighton.

To carry out these works safely, we’ll need overnight closures 8pm to 6am on the A27 between Amex Stadium and Southerham Roundabout. We will work week nights only.

Closure information:

A27 eastbound carriageway from Southerham roundabout to Amex Stadium

  • Monday 4 August to Friday 15 August

A27 westbound carriageway from Amex Stadium to Southerham roundabout.

  • Monday 18 August to Thursday 4 September

(please note there will be no overnight closures on 22 and 25 August)

A signed diversion will be in place via A26, A259 and A270 in both directions.
